Suggest a better descriptionBring 2 quarts water to boil and add 1 teaspoon salt and 1 tablespoon red vinegar. Add mussels, octopus and prawns and boil 1 minute. Prawns should redden and mussels start to open. Add squid and crayfish and cook until squid is just translucent, about 1 minute. Drain everything and place in warm bowl. Add scallions, vinegar, olive oil, peppers, salt and pepper and mint and toss to coat. Add greens, toss again and serve warm with lemon wedges.
